    Kedarnath temple safe, to remain out of bounds for a year: CM

    The famous Kedarnath shrine located in the Himalayan ranges in rain-ravaged Uttarakhand is safe but will remain out of bounds for at least one year, Chief Minister of state, Vijay Bahuguna said today. "Kedarnath shrine is safe but it is under a lot of slush," he told reporters here after a meeting with Prime Minister Manmohan Singh, who announced Rs 1,000 crore aid to the state...
